When I started with Experience Triathlon and Coach Joe I was a beginner Triathlete who was a complete coach potato, through Joe's coaching I was able to do my first Triathlon in only 3 months, I lost 15lbs, 5% body fat, and 62 points on my cholesteral. I wouldn't have been able to prepare myself for my first triathlon without the help of ET. You won't find a friendly, more motivating, more fun coach out there. I have been an athlete on different levels for years with many coaches and Joe is by far the best and more friendly coach I have ever had. He is worth every penny, I would pay double or more for the services he offers because he is worth every penny. I know that if I have any triathlon goals that Joe is the guy who will get me there. I have met tons of wonderful people to train with, and opened up my mind to thoughts of doing things I would have never though possible without Joe's help. I'm a first time triathlete but I have goals now of possibly doing an Olympic next year, and maybe an Ironman someday.
